As a 6-bed assisted living facility, Monica's ALF represents one of the smaller care settings available in the Miami-Dade County area. Florida's assisted living sector includes a wide range of facility sizes, from small residential homes to large institutional campuses. Facilities with fewer than seven beds are commonly referred to as small family-style residences and may offer a more intimate living environment compared to larger licensed communities. About AHCA Licensing
Florida assisted living facilities are licensed and inspected by the Agency for Health Care Administration (AHCA). Unlike Medicare-certified nursing homes, ALFs are not rated on the CMS 1โ5 star scale.
Deficiency classes range from Class I (immediate serious harm) to Class IV (low potential for harm). Substantiated complaints are those confirmed by AHCA investigators.
